Three candidates were assessed: Quellan Materials, Briarhalt Chemical, and Osmund Resins. Quellan offered the best landed cost but requires a twelve-week qualification run; Briarhalt matched specifications immediately at a premium. Sample testing is complete and finance has modelled dual-sourcing scenarios, with working-capital impact within tolerance. A recommendation is due at the next review. The confidential note on business plans follows below.

management briefing: Goroxix Systems is in early talks to buy Kelethek Holdings for about $118.0 million. The Sileth launch date is February 25, and nothing goes to the press before then. Legal wants the Pelokox Logistics term sheet withdrawn before December 14.

## Changelog — Deploybot defaults (v2.4)

Heads up, future maintainers: we changed Deploybot's defaults after too many noisy channels. Status pings now post only on failures and final success, not every stage; the polling interval doubled; and thread replies are on by default so rollouts stay in one place. Nobody complained in the pilot rooms, so this ships everywhere. If you need to tweak things later, the new default configuration is shown below.

service settings:
PRAIX_LOG_LEVEL=error
PRAIX_METRICS_HOST=metrics.praix.qorvelcorp.corp
PRAIX_POOL_SIZE=16

Quarterly Planning — Commission Scheme, Veldane Instruments

For the incoming director: the revised scheme shifts weighting from bookings to collected revenue, capped accelerators at 140%. Pilot ran in the Corvane region with acceptable results. Rollout targeted for Q3 kickoff. The planning assumptions driving this change are set out below.

internal memo for kaduf-baduf: Only 35 of the 378 pilot accounts renewed Holir, so a churn review is set for June 11. Eliielax Group is in early talks to buy Silaelix Group for about $142.1 million.

PayLoop's retry layer derives idempotency keys by hashing the payment intent with a service-level secret. Without it, retries generate fresh keys and you get double charges. Reviewers: reject any PR that hardcodes this value or logs it.

Required vars: `PAYLOOP_RETRY_WINDOW` (seconds), `PAYLOOP_KEY_PREFIX` (env-specific), and the key-derivation secret itself. The first two are non-sensitive and set in the shared config. The derivation secret must live only in the local env file, on the line directly after this sentence.

vault entry, kafog-yahop: COURIER_KEY8=0faa53ae